2024 年全球盲点解决方案市场规模约为 203.2 亿美元,预计在 2025 年至 2035 年的预测期内,年复合成长率(CAGR) 将达到惊人的 12.15%。随着对道路安全、智慧旅行和事故缓解的日益重视,盲点解决方案在所有类型车辆中都变得越来越不可或缺。这些解决方案——从基于雷达的侦测系统和摄影机辅助监控到先进的虚拟支柱——旨在消除驾驶员的盲区,显着减少变换车道事故,并提高拥堵交通条件下的机动性。 ADAS(高级驾驶辅助系统)的普及、全球交通部门更严格的安全规定以及现代车辆电子系统的加速集成,都推动了盲点市场的成长轨迹。

消费者意识的提升,加上感测器融合和车辆感知技术的持续创新,正在重塑汽车安全格局。从基于摄影机的监控到超音波和雷达驱动的侦测系统,製造商正在大力投资改进盲点侦测功能,以提升驾驶信心并最大程度地降低碰撞风险。纯电动车 (BEV)、插电式混合动力车 (PHEV) 和燃料电池电动车 (FCEV) 的广泛普及,进一步增加了对智慧驾驶辅助功能的需求,为盲点解决方案创造了广阔的商机。此外,随着车主积极为旧款车型加装先进的安全部件以符合不断变化的保险激励措施和监管要求,售后市场也呈现出显着增长势头。

从区域来看,北美凭藉其早期的技术应用、完善的汽车安全标准以及知名原始设备製造商 (OEM) 和一级供应商的存在,成为盲点解决方案市场的主导中心。尤其是美国,其对新车平台整合 ADAS 的要求非常严格,这持续刺激了产品需求。欧洲紧随其后,得益于其零愿景安全计画、不断增长的豪华车需求以及不断进步的汽车法规。同时,受中国、日本、韩国和印度汽车产量激增、城市人口成长以及电动车基础设施扩张的推动,亚太地区正成为成长最快的市场。这些地区政府支持的汽车安全计画和不断增长的可支配收入也在推动消费者对增强型车载安全技术的需求。

The Global Blind Spot Solutions Market was valued at approximately USD 20.32 billion in 2024 and is anticipated to witness an impressive compound annual growth rate (CAGR) of 12.15% throughout the forecast period from 2025 to 2035. With the growing emphasis on road safety, intelligent mobility, and accident mitigation, blind spot solutions are increasingly becoming indispensable across all classes of vehicles. These solutions-ranging from radar-based detection systems and camera-assisted monitoring to advanced virtual pillars-are designed to eliminate the driver's blind zones, significantly reducing lane-changing accidents and improving maneuverability in congested traffic conditions. The upward trajectory of the market is being bolstered by the rising deployment of ADAS (Advanced Driver Assistance Systems), stricter safety mandates from global transport authorities, and the accelerating integration of electronic systems in modern vehicles.

The surge in consumer awareness, coupled with ongoing innovations in sensor fusion and vehicle perception technologies, is reshaping the automotive safety landscape. From camera-based monitoring to ultrasonic and radar-driven detection systems, manufacturers are investing heavily in refining blind spot detection capabilities to elevate driver confidence and minimize collision risks. The widespread adoption of battery electric vehicles (BEVs), plug-in hybrids (PHEVs), and fuel-cell electric vehicles (FCEVs) has further augmented the demand for intelligent driver assistance features, creating expansive opportunities for blind spot solutions. Moreover, the aftermarket channel is witnessing notable traction as vehicle owners actively retrofit older models with advanced safety components in line with evolving insurance incentives and regulatory requirements.

Regionally, North America stands as a dominant hub in the blind spot solutions market due to early technological adoption, well-established automotive safety standards, and the presence of prominent OEMs and Tier-1 suppliers. The U.S., in particular, has enforced strict mandates on ADAS integration in new vehicle platforms, which continues to fuel product demand. Europe follows closely, underpinned by its vision-zero safety initiatives, rising demand for luxury vehicles, and progressive automotive legislation. Meanwhile, the Asia Pacific region is emerging as the fastest-growing market, propelled by burgeoning automotive production, increasing urban population, and the expansion of EV infrastructure in China, Japan, South Korea, and India. Government-backed vehicle safety programs and growing disposable incomes in these regions are also nudging consumers towards enhanced in-vehicle safety technologies.
